NVIDIA GeForce GTX 1050 Ti vs Intel Arc Pro A50

We compared two Desktop platform GPUs: 4GB VRAM GeForce GTX 1050 Ti and 6GB VRAM Arc Pro A50 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

Intel Arc Pro A50 's Advantages
Released 5 years and 10 months late
Boost Clock has increased by 69% (2350MHz vs 1392MHz)
More VRAM (6GB vs 4GB)
Larger VRAM bandwidth (192.0GB/s vs 112.1GB/s)
256 additional rendering cores
